Title:
TWO-DIMENSIONAL TOPOLOGY PHOTONIC CRYSTAL CAVITY, DESIGN METHOD THEREOF AND APPLICATION IN LASER

Abstract:
A two-dimensional topology photonic crystal cavity, a design method thereof and an application in a laser. The two-dimensional topology photonic crystal cavity comprises multiple photonic crystal supercells, the multiple photonic crystal supercells having vortex-shaped structural variation around a center of the two-dimensional topology photonic crystal cavity, and bands of the multiple photonic crystal supercells having Dirac points at balanced positions of the vortex-shaped structural variation. The two-dimensional topology photonic crystal cavity, also called a Dirac vortex cavity, is characterized by having a large mode field area, a large free spectral range, a narrow light beam divergence angle, arbitrary mode degeneracy and compatibility with multiple types of substrate material, and may be used in a surface-emitting semiconductor laser, enabling stable single-transverse-mode and single-longitudinal-mode operation, while ensuring broad-area and high-energy output of a laser.
